Sviluppare funzionalita su Microsoft Office con VBA Funzione dir in vba 2019 e 2016

LoginRegistrati
Stai vedendo 4 articoli - dal 1 a 4 (di 4 totali)
  • Autore
    Articoli
  • #27188 Risposta

    flavio
    Partecipante

      Salve qualcuno puà spiegarmi perchè "VBA.filesystem.dir"  funziona per trovare un file excel dentro una cartella e "Dir" non funziona in excel 2016 ?

      #27193 Risposta
      patel
      patel
      Moderatore
        39 pts

        Mostra il codice completo che stai usando e spiegati meglio

        #27194 Risposta

        flavio
        Partecipante

          Se utilizzo questo codice in vba 2016 ottengo come risultato a fname ="" ovvero che non ha trovato i file nella cartella 

          folderName = "C:\Users\Flavio\Desktop\lavoro\"
              If Right(folderName, 1) <> Application.PathSeparator Then folderName = folderName & Application.PathSeparator
              fName = Dir(folderName & "*.xls")
          

           

          Se utilizzo questo funge

          FName = VBA.FileSystem.Dir(“folderName & "*.xls")
          #27198 Risposta
          zer0kelvin
          zer0kelvin
          Partecipante
            5 pts

            Ciao.

            Dir funziona regolarmente su tutte le versioni di Excel comprese le due che hai citato, quindi il problema e dovuto a qualcos'altro.

            Potresti provare a ripristinare Office.

          LoginRegistrati
          Stai vedendo 4 articoli - dal 1 a 4 (di 4 totali)
          Rispondi a: Funzione dir in vba 2019 e 2016
          Gli allegati sono permessi solo ad utenti REGISTRATI
          Le tue informazioni:



          vecchio frac - 2750 risposte

          albatros54
          albatros54 - 1009 risposte

          patel
          patel - 956 risposte

          Marius44
          Marius44 - 824 risposte

          Luca73
          Luca73 - 696 risposte